Head and neck surgical teams provide treatment for problems of the ears, sinuses, mouth, pharynx, jaw, and other structures of the head and neck.

When one has the following symptoms, one needs head and neck surgery. The symptoms include a lump or sore in the head and neck region that does not heal, a sore throat that does not go away, swallowing difficulty, etc.

Oral maxillofacial surgery is often needed to treat diseases and injuries to the head, neck, face and jaw. One might need this type of surgery if they have neck cancer, for example.
